Hair Growth Products For Females

If you're suffering from hair loss, you're not alone. Millions of women experience some form of hair loss. That's why there are so many hair growth products for women.


Types


There are four types of products that have been shown to help regrow hair in women. They are: DHT inhibitors, androgen blockers, anti-inflammatories and growth stimulants.








Identification


DHT and androgen are associated with less active hair follicles and baldness. So DHT inhibitors and androgen blockers can be effective treatments. Revignon is one of the hair growth products for women that does both. Anti-inflammatory products, like Nizoral shampoo, help calm the scalp, which encourages hair growth. Add in growth stimulants, like Rogaine, and you can see how using these treatments together approach the problem from all angles.


Misconceptions








There are a few products that some people mistakenly think are effective hair growth products for women. Steroids and vitamins won't help, and steroids can actually cause hair loss. Miracle products that claim to thicken hair don't work, either, because the number of follicles you have --and their width -- is genetic.


Prevention/Solution


There isn't much scientific evidence to back it up, but there is anecdotal evidence that some techniques may work to prevent hair loss. Massaging the scalp, avoiding wearing hair pulled back tightly and avoiding processing supposedly help prevent hair loss. However, according to science, the only way to see a significant difference is by using the hair growth products for women mentioned above.


Warning


You may experience a period of "shedding" right after you start using these hair growth products for women. It's brief and completely normal, so it's important that you don't stop your treatments.
